#A658BA Hex Color Code

#A658BA

The Hexadecimal Color #A658BA is a contrast shade of Medium Orchid. #A658BA RGB value is rgb(166, 88, 186). RGB Color Model of #A658BA consists of 65% red, 34% green and 72% blue. HSL color Mode of #A658BA has 288°(degrees) Hue, 42%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#A658BA color has an wavelength of 438.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A658BA is #CC66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A658BA is #A5B. The Closest Color to #A658BA is #BA55D3. Official Name of #A658BA Hex Code is Wisteria.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A658BA is 11 Cyan 53 Magenta 0 Yellow 27 Black and #A658BA CMY is 11, 53,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A658BA is hsl(288,42,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(288, 53, 73).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A658BA is 28.08, 18.63, 48.56.
Hex8 Value of #A658BA is #A658BAFF. Decimal Value of #A658BA is 10901690 and Octal Value of #A658BA is 51454272. Binary Value of #A658BA is 10100110, 1011000, 10111010 and Android of #A658BA is 4289091770 / 0xffa658ba.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A658BA is 0.295, 0.196, 0.196 and YIQ Color Space of #A658BA is 122.494, 14.9928, 46.9946.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A658BA is 20.69, 12.16, 48.09.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A658BA is 50.25, 47.44, -38.58.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A658BA is 50.25, 32.66, -64.28.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A658BA is 50.25, 61.15, 320.88. Hunter Lab variable of #A658BA is 43.16, 40.59, -36.49.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A658BA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
